We have an amazing opportunity for a UX-leaning Product Designer, who is looking to use their skills and experience to make a positive social impact.
Futureheads is partnered with an inspirational non-profit organisation with a rich history of providing support to individuals, local communities and public health services across the UK.
The charity has just commenced a major digital transformation programme, with the goal of creating new ‘tech-for-good’ products to further facilitate their incredible mission. They’ve been assembling a talented internal digital team to deliver this work, and they’re now looking to make their first in-house Product Design hire.
As a Product Designer, you will lead the design of a greenfield web platform; shaping new solutions, user journeys, and experiences for both the consumers and businesses that will interact with it. Furthermore, you’ll contribute towards the development of their design system, validate new ideas and build out shared components that will serve as the standard for new products to come.
This role will suit a Product Designer that leans towards UX, as you'll be owning, planning and delivering all user research and testing. And as the charity’s first permanent in-house designer, it’s crucial that you’re able to work autonomously and can bring the breadth of experience to implement ‘best practice’ for UCD, ultimately establishing the benchmark / processes for design and research across the org.
